Additional Information

➢ More than 28 years of corrections experience in a variety of challenging locations and positions with the Federal Bureau of Prisons. ➢ Over 16 years as CEO/President of SIMCO Correctional Consulting, LLC, where I personally provide correctional and jail consulting, advocacy, and expert witness expertise for a variety of clients, in both the private and government sector. Have been regarded as a leading expert in the field of jail and prison management for over 1 ½ decades. ➢ Six months as Assistant Director of the West Central Community Action Agency, a contract agency for the US Department of Health and Human Resources. ➢ Over one year as Warden at the Correctional Corporation of America’s Northeast Ohio Correctional Center in Youngstown, Ohio. ➢ Nine (9) months as Warden at the Cornell Companies’ and GEO Group Great Plains Correctional Facility in Hinton, Oklahoma. ➢ Twenty-one (21) years of experience in correctional supervisory and management ➢ Thirteen (13) years of experience in correctional executive level management as an Associate Warden, Warden, and Regional Director ➢ Two years experience as Regional Director for the Federal Bureau of Prisons’ Western Region, where I was responsible for complete oversight of 18 institutions and supervising all wardens at these facilities and 65 regional office administrators and other staff. ➢ Three years of experience at the Federal Bureau of Prisons Headquarters, with emphasis in training, policy development, crisis evaluation, crisis intervention, and auditing ➢ Regarded as an expert in all areas of correctional management, oversight, inmate care and custody, policy, ethics, and training.
